The Basilica of Our Lady of Hanswijk is a basilica in Mechelen. The current baroque church was built between 1663 and 1681 according to the plan of architect Lucas Faydherbe. The first stone was laid in 1663 by Archbishop Andreas Cruesen. The basilica was put into operation on May 30, 1678. The rotunda has a diameter of 15.50 m, the dome reaches a height of 34 m. History: in the hamlet of Hanswijk, on the banks of the Dijle, in the 10th century a loaded ship that could not be reached stranded, someone came up with the idea to bring the Our Lady's image to the shore. Now the boat sails on again. The inhabitants decided that Maria wanted to be honored. The statue was transferred to a nearby place of worship, dedicated to Lambert and Catharina. The chapel quickly became one crowded place of pilgrimage. |
